Second Mortgage Versus Home Equity Loan – I now avoid the term "home equity loan" and use "HELOC" to refer to any mortgage loan structured as a line of credit. While most of these loans are second mortgages, some are first mortgages. If you own your house free and clear and you want a line of credit secured by a mortgage, that loan is a HELOC, even though it is a first mortgage.

What is the difference between a traditional second mortgage and a home equity line of credit? Both traditional seconds as well as home equity lines of credit are technically considered second mortgages. With a traditional second mortgage, the rate is typically fixed and all funds are paid out at closing.
